Hair testing is increasingly recognized as a potent means for identifying drug and alcohol consumption. Hair offers an extensive history of drug and alcohol use by capturing biomarkers in the strands of growing hair. When taken from the scalp, hair can provide up to a three-month detection period for substances. It's easy to gather, relatively hard to tamper with, and simple to transport.
A 1.5-inch sample of roughly 200 hair strands (akin to a #2 pencil's width) near the scalp will yield 100mg of hair, the ideal volume for evaluation and corroboration. For EtG, additional tests, or tests above 10 panels, 150mg is suggested. We advise weighing the sample on a jeweler’s scale. If scalp hair isn't present, a similar quantity of body hair can be used. When discussing head hair, we are specifically referring to scalp hair. Body hair includes all other hair types (facial, axillary, etc.).
Process Overview
The core components of lab processing for a drug test are Accessioning, Screening, Extraction, and Confirmation.
Accessioning is the initial incorporation of a sample into a lab system. This process entails ensuring the sample was sealed and shipped correctly, assigning a random LAN (Laboratory Accessioning Number), and completing any extra data input not covered by an electronic chain of custody system.
Screening involves a preliminary rapid check for substance abuse. Although Screening is an economical method to rule out drug use in most cases, a positive result must be confirmed for court admissibility. Any samples presumed positive in Screening require additional confirmation.
For samples presumed positive in Screening, more hair is taken from the original specimen and readied for Extraction. During this phase, drugs are extracted from hair at much lower concentrations than with other methods (e.g., urine or oral fluid), which is why hair drug testing is notably challenging.
Positive Screening results are confirmed through GC/MS, GC/MS/MS, or LC/MS/MS. All presumptive samples undergo washing before confirmation as necessary. The full lab process from Accessioning to Confirmation is examined under both the CAP (College of American Pathologists) Hair designation and the accreditation to ISO / IEC 17025 standards.

Note: Although termed "hair follicle tests", the analysis is conducted on the hair strand, not under the scalp's hair follicle.
